Mumbai one of the biggest metropolitan cities in the world has a huge coastline dotted by buildings that showcase the history of the 'Maximum City' over the last 300 years.
The tour is designed to visit some famous landmarks and some spots which are famous among locals but doesn't have any mention in travel guide books. This tour gives a brief insight about local life in Mumbai.
You visit iconic Appollo Harbour, where you see Gateway of India & Taj Mahal Hotel along with other heritage buildings in the vicinity. You visit the Nariman point, one of the most expensive neighbourhood in the world. Marine Drive is the heart of Mumbai, the best way to explore the local life.
Constructed in the 20th century, this arch was built as a tribute to the British Royals on their visit to India. The Gateway of India overlooks the Arabian Sea and welcomes visitors in large numbers every single day. It has an intricate blend of the Hindu and Muslim styles of architecture.

Le palais du Taj Mahal, Mumbai
One of the iconic building in Mumbai is the oldest hotel in Mumbai. Famous for Victorian-Indian architecture.

Nariman Point
Located at one end of the city, it is famous for high rise commercial buildings and beach facing properties. The sunset is a must watch from this spot soaking in the beauty of nature.

Marine Drive
Officially called the Netaji Subhash Chandra Bose Road, today Marine Drive is famously referred to as the Queen’s Necklace. It got its name after the view of the street lights at night that resemble the pearls of a necklace when viewed from an elevation.

Worli Sea Face
The 2 km seafront walkway is the highlight of the city with many people using it for running, walking, jogging or spending quiet time on the sea amidst the chaos of the city.

Promenade du kiosque à musique
If you want to have a chill day and just stroll or jog around, Bandra Promenade, also known as Bandra Bandstand is the place for you. It offers 1.2 kilometers long walkway along the sea on the western coast of Mumbai, with the best view possible.

Plage de Juhu
Located on the shores of the Arabian sea, stretched six kilometers up to Versova, Juhu has never failed to attract the mass. Also, if you want to have some mindboggling Mumbai style street food, you’re welcome here
